Michelle Kennedy got what she taught while expanding internet dating apps Badoo and Bumble to devise online community app Peanut, which links lady talking about motherhood.

Are a mother can feel like life on a deserted area. Michelle Kennedy aims to acquire links for ladies experiencing that solitude.

No colored volleyballs necessary.

She’s the president and CEO of London-based Peanut, a social networking app that allows promising mothers, planning on mothers, new parents, experienced parents and empty-nester parents relate genuinely to women near these people exactly who communicate the company’s pursuits, grievances and problems.

Since their launch in 2017, Peanut has long been about making motherhood smoother — while overlooking whoever isn’t a mommy by themselves in the process. But even though the app is only to be found in the U.S., Canada, Aussie-land and also the U.K., it’s got nevertheless garnered intercontinental press awareness due to its “Tinder for mothers” model from your wants of TechCrunch, Uproxx and so the Bump, a website for anticipating and latest mothers.

Obese a recorded user bottom of more than 500,000 females (and rising) just who indulge several times each and every day on your application, Kennedy provides a number of appropriate reasons to have confidence in them hyper-focused version.
